Delaware Middle School Mistakenly Chosen For Reforms

WILMINGTON, Del. (AP) -- Delaware state education officials say a Wilmington middle school has been mistakenly listed as one of the worst in the state.

Secretary of Education Lillian Lowery announced the error regarding Bayard Middle School on Monday. The state used faulty data when it picked Bayard to be part of the Partnership Zones program, which requires big changes at schools in return for extra money.

It's not known exactly what new programs will be implemented now at Bayard, however Lowery says she expects the school to continue reform work.

Officials double-checked the data for other schools on the Partnership Zone list and didn't find any other mistakes.
